Default Re: Does Entrecard bring loyal readers?

I should be very clear...

I have gotten readers from Entrecard. It is for that reason I don't take the widget off of my site. It will also give you a slight Alexa bump by having it on your site.

However, my main complaint is the reward for the cost of dropping cards.

Some of the top valued sites on EC are basically addicted to dropping. If they stopped dropping, all their traffic would disappear because they don't have content to justify the numbers they have.

I now only drop when I encounter a site via normal reading or stumbling which has a widget. I average about 10-20 per day.
